Lyrics Page

How To Apologize

By Brandon Heath

328 views Feb 16, 2026 updated

I can change a flat tire seven minutes give or take a few seconds
I can ride a surfboard on a wave never had any lessons
I can tell you every president by name
Sing you every single word of Purple Rain
I can drive to Arizona without checking directions
But I'm still learning how to apologize

I can take a few lines from a book turn it into a love song
I like to think that I'm a pretty good friend someone to lean on
I can tell you where to buy a good guitar
And you know I can find Orion in a stars
I can recommend a really good therapist if you ever need one
But I'm still learning how to apologize

Yeah I know that no one's perfect
And I hope you see I'm working
I don't mean to leave you hurting
Can you see that I'm still learning
How to apologize
How to apologize

I can fry an egg sunny side up no breaking the yellow
I can turn on the Tennessee charm have you at hello
I can talk my way out of any fight
Drink my coffee in the middle of the night
But when I start thinking maybe you were right
I turn into jello
I'm still learning how to apologize
(Still learning how to apologize)

Yeah I know that no one's perfect
And I hope you see I'm working
I don't mean to leave you hurting
Can you see that I'm still learning
How to apologize
How to apologize
I must have done it a thousand times
Still learning how to apologize

I don't know what to tell you
Cause the one thing left to say
Is nothing short of a breakthrough
So I hide it inside but my pride keeps on getting in the way
Sorry
Sorry
Sorry

Yeah I know that no one's perfect
And I hope you see I'm working
I don't mean to leave you hurting
Can you see that I'm still learning
How to apologize
(Sorry sorry)
How to apologize
(Sorry sorry)
I must have done it a thousand times
(Sorry)
Can you see that I'm still learning how to apologize

Official Video

Save Your Favorites

Create a free account to save songs, build your personal library, and connect with the Zion community.

Create Free Account

Join the Zion Community

Create a free account to save your favorite lyrics, submit song suggestions, and connect with fellow worshippers.

No spam. Unsubscribe anytime.